Julie Owono, a digital rights advocate and Executive Director of Internet Sans Frontières from Cameroon; Maina Kiai, a human rights activist and Director of Human Rights Watch’s Global Alliances and Partnerships programme from Kenya; and Afia Asantewaa Asare-Kyei, a human rights lawyer and Programme Manager at the Open Society Initiative for West Africa from Senegal, Ghana and South Africa, have been appointed as Board Members to the newly created Oversight Board.
